walbassuk Posted July 16, 2015 Share Posted July 16, 2015 (edited) A year on from originally listing, here is a very good example of the Jazz breed now only used as a practice bass, which is a shame and I'm sure it would love to be front and centre once again. What we have here is a Squire Vintage Modified 4 string fretted bass that has a maple neck with black block inlays and is fitted with a BadAss bridge and wizard 64 pickups, so a natural wood, Geddy Lee style, Jazz bass. It is in near mint condition, the BadAss and pickups was fitted by someone who knew what they were doing, i.e. not me. It's a very good Jazz and with the added bonus of a very small price as l would like to see it go to a new home. Will include strap with fitted strap locks. I'm in Milton Keynes but travel around quite a lot as a field engineer. I'll post at cost if required.
